الفرق بين المراجعتين ل"Sass/percentage"

من موسوعة حسوب
اذهب إلى التنقل اذهب إلى البحث
ط
سطر 1: سطر 1:
 
<noinclude>{{DISPLAYTITLE: الدالة <code>()percentage</code> في Sass}}</noinclude>
 
<noinclude>{{DISPLAYTITLE: الدالة <code>()percentage</code> في Sass}}</noinclude>
تحوّل الدالة <code>percentage()‎</code> عددًا دون واحدة إلى نسبة مئوية.
+
تحوّل الدالة <code>percentage()‎</code> عددًا دون وحدة إلى نسبة مئوية.
 
== البنية العامة ==
 
== البنية العامة ==
 
<syntaxhighlight lang="sass">
 
<syntaxhighlight lang="sass">
سطر 9: سطر 9:
  
 
=== <code>‎$number</code> ===
 
=== <code>‎$number</code> ===
عددٌ طبيعي دون واحدة.
+
عددٌ طبيعي دون وحدة.
  
 
== القيم المعادة ==
 
== القيم المعادة ==
سطر 15: سطر 15:
  
 
== الأخطاء والاستثناءات ==
 
== الأخطاء والاستثناءات ==
سيُرمى الخطأ <code>ArgumentError</code> إن كان المعامل <code>‎$number</code> عددًا له واحدة.
+
سيُرمى الخطأ <code>ArgumentError</code> إن كان المعامل <code>‎$number</code> عددًا له وحدة.
  
 
== أمثلة ==
 
== أمثلة ==
سطر 23: سطر 23:
 
}
 
}
 
</syntaxhighlight>سيُصرّف المثال السابق إلى شيفرة <nowiki/>[[CSS]] الآتية:<syntaxhighlight lang="css">
 
</syntaxhighlight>سيُصرّف المثال السابق إلى شيفرة <nowiki/>[[CSS]] الآتية:<syntaxhighlight lang="css">
selector {
+
.selector {
   width: 20%;
+
   width: 20%; }
}
 
 
</syntaxhighlight>
 
</syntaxhighlight>
  
 
== انظر أيضًا ==
 
== انظر أيضًا ==
 
* الدالة <code>[[Sass/round|round()]]</code>‎: تقرِّب العدد الممرَّر إليها.
 
* الدالة <code>[[Sass/round|round()]]</code>‎: تقرِّب العدد الممرَّر إليها.
 
 
* الدالة <code>[[Sass/abs|abs()]]</code>‎: تعيد القيمة المطلقة للعدد الممرَّر إليها.
 
* الدالة <code>[[Sass/abs|abs()]]</code>‎: تعيد القيمة المطلقة للعدد الممرَّر إليها.
 
* الدالة <code>[[Sass/max|max()]]</code>‎: تعيد القيمة الأكبر من بين مجموعة الأعداد الممرَّر إليها.
 
* الدالة <code>[[Sass/max|max()]]</code>‎: تعيد القيمة الأكبر من بين مجموعة الأعداد الممرَّر إليها.

مراجعة 11:20، 17 مايو 2018

تحوّل الدالة percentage()‎ عددًا دون وحدة إلى نسبة مئوية.

البنية العامة

percentage($number)

المعاملات

‎$number

عددٌ طبيعي دون وحدة.

القيم المعادة

تُعاد نسبة مئوية تمثِّل العدد ‎$number.

الأخطاء والاستثناءات

سيُرمى الخطأ ArgumentError إن كان المعامل ‎$number عددًا له وحدة.

أمثلة

مثال عن استخدام الدالة percentage()‎  لضبط قيمة العرض (width):

selector {
  width: percentage(0.2) // 20%
}

سيُصرّف المثال السابق إلى شيفرة CSS الآتية:

.selector {
  width: 20%; }

انظر أيضًا

  • الدالة round()‎: تقرِّب العدد الممرَّر إليها.
  • الدالة abs()‎: تعيد القيمة المطلقة للعدد الممرَّر إليها.
  • الدالة max()‎: تعيد القيمة الأكبر من بين مجموعة الأعداد الممرَّر إليها.

مصادر